@RAV0004, Larty

The deck this is in has a couple of creatures with "destroy target nonblack creature" (Dark Hatchling and Throat Slitter). This can kill black creatures. It's support for your killers.
Atali
★★★★★ (5.0/5.0) (1 vote)
The reasoning behind putting this into the precon is that it's easy to see that it needs to be replaced, and there are many upgrades to choose from. Wizards doesn't want to print optimized precons, because they want players to have the fun of tinkering with their new decks, and buy more cards in the process.
Go for the Throat would be my ideal replacement, though compelling arguments can be made for many cards. Peel from Reality would provide some nice utility, and can help remove obstacles for to your Ninjas.
